Bit sample point
: Possible values are between 50 and 90 [%]. It is the point when a high
level is measured. A good value is round about 75 (default value)

Time Stamp
:
Timestamp is in nano seconds [ns] resolution and with an accuracy of 40 nano
seconds [ns] (starting with epoch time, if no PTP master is connected)
Messages Received
: Counter for received messages on this port from the connected
CAN-Bus
Messages with Error
: Counter for received messages on this port from the connected
CAN-Bus containing an error. For example, CRC errors.
